2017-03-15 · The Nottingham grading (modified Bloom–Richardson grading) system is a well-known international grading system for breast cancer recommended by the WHO, which encompasses three visual morphology attributes (degree of tubular formation, nuclear pleomorphism, and mitotic activity), each of which is scored on a scale of 1–3 to produce a combined Nottingham score of 3–9, representing low

In the Nottingham/Tenovus Primary Breast Cancer Study the most commonly used method, described by Bloom & Richardson, has been modified 2019-05-05 Nottingham Grading System International breast cancer grading system recommended by the World Health Organization 3 criteria: 1 Gland (acinus) formation (score 1 - 2 - 3) 2 Nuclear atypia / pleomorphism (score 1 - 2 - 3) 3 Mitosis counts (score 1 - 2 - 3) Final grading: Add scores for acinus formation, nuclear atypia and mitosis count.

Nottingham grading system is based on three conventional criteria; mitotic count, tubule formation, and nuclear pleomorphism. Doctors most often use the Nottingham grading system (also called the Elston-Ellis modification of the Scarff-Bloom-Richardson grading system) for breast cancer . This system grades breast tumors based on the following features: Tubule formation: how much of the tumor tissue has normal breast …

Grade 2 or moderately differentiated (score 6, 7). The cells are growing at a speed of and look like cells somewhere between grades 1 and 3. Grade 3 or poorly differentiated (score 8, 9).
